Expiration Date and Shelf Life
One of the most important factors to consider when purchasing Skincare Products from clearance sections is the expiration date and shelf life of the products. Skincare Products, especially those with active ingredients, can lose their efficacy over time. Using expired products can also be harmful to your skin and cause irritation or breakouts.
Before making a purchase, check the expiration date on the packaging and make sure the product still has a good amount of shelf life left. Avoid purchasing products that are close to expiring or have already passed their expiration date.
Ingredients List
Another crucial factor to consider is the ingredients list of the Skincare Products. It's essential to know what ingredients are in the product to ensure that they are suitable for your skin type and concerns. Some ingredients can cause allergic reactions or irritation, so it's essential to do a patch test before using the product on your face.
When purchasing from clearance sections, take the time to read the ingredients list and avoid products that contain potential irritants or allergens. Look for products with natural ingredients or those that are free from parabens, sulfates, and artificial fragrances.
Reputable Brands
While clearance sections might offer discounted Skincare Products, it's crucial to look for reputable brands when making a purchase. Some clearance sections may carry products that are discontinued or no longer in season, but that doesn't mean they are not effective. Do some research on the brand and read reviews from other customers to ensure you are purchasing quality products.
Before buying Skincare Products from clearance sections, make sure to check the brand's reputation and look for any red flags. Avoid purchasing products from brands you've never heard of or those that have received negative feedback from customers.
